Masthaven revamps range

16 April, 2015

By: Robyn Hall

category: Commercial, Residential, Secured, Short Term

0

Masthaven Finance has revamped its product range and lowered its minimum loan size from £50,000 to £30,000 as it looks to bring innovation to the market.

Its new products cater for UK nationals living overseas and non-UK registered companies, while other new products are for seconds renovation and seconds commercial.

The lender, specialising in bridging and secured loans, will accept loans from expats across all of its ranges, while it will open up its offering to UK residents with a right to reside with foreign passports from China and India.

Masthaven wants to continue bringing new products to market over the next 12 months.

Andrew Bloom, its managing director, said: “As a company, we are keen to open up new opportunities to lend and from the feedback of key introducers, we have looked at lending in areas which have not been exploited by lenders in the past.

“The end result is a raft of new products and enhancements. We have also looked at the pricing model and made reductions across our product range which I know will be welcomed by introducers.

“While maintaining our strong stance on the quality of business we write, all of the fresh initiatives will provide our introducers with new opportunities to help their clients.

“Our aim is to be the leader in bringing innovative products to advisers, matched by the peerless Masthaven service our introducers have come to expect from us.”
